This easy to build PCB with printed enclosure provides an additional 8 digital inputs (or 25mA outputs) and 8 outputs with 500mA each, controlled by I2C. It is based on the [MCP23017](https://www.microchip.com/wwwproducts/en/MCP23017) 16-Bit I2C I/O Expander, the outputs are driven by a ULN2803.
The enclosure has connectors for the [fischertechnik construction toy system](https://www.fischertechnik.de/en) and uses my printed flush sleeve design ("[Printbuchse](https://www.thingiverse.com/thing:3375338)") for the fischertechnik typical 2.6mm jacks. The outputs can drive ft-parts like lamps, magnets, valves, or (undirectional, mono-speed) motors. Combine two or more of the ULN2803 driven outputs, if you need more than 500mA.
* The 2x3 pin I2C connector is pin compatible with other ft I2C cables ([ftDuino](http://ftduino.de/), TX).
